1-2 Safety Precautions

 dangerous situations. If you need repairs, contact an SAMSUNG Service Center or your dealer.




 The gas and electrical supplies to the appliance should be turned off and/or disconnected when the range is
 being serviced or repaired.




          WARNING

    on/servicing the appliance.

    supply before working on/servicing the appliance. IF YOU SMELL GAS:
    1. DO NOT light a match, candle, or cigarette.
    2. DO NOT turn on any gas or electric appliances.
    3. DO NOT touch any electrical switches.
    4. DO NOT use any type of phone in the building.
    5. Clear the room, building, or area of all occupants.
    6. Immediately call the gas supplier from a phone outside of the building. Follow the gas supplier's
       instructions.
